The Brewster Hospital building is a special historic place in the LaVilla neighborhood of Jacksonville, Florida. You can find it at 915 West Monroe Street. On May 13, 1976, this building was added to the U.S. National Register of Historic Places. This means it's recognized as an important historical site for the country.

History of Brewster Hospital

Brewster Hospital was the very first hospital in Jacksonville that served African American people. It helped the Black community in Jacksonville from 1901 until 1966.

Why Brewster Hospital Was Needed

The hospital was started in 1901 after a huge fire, called the Great Fire of 1901, destroyed much of Jacksonville. At that time, there was no place for Black people to go for medical care. Hospitals for white people did not treat Black residents.

So, the George A. Brewster Hospital and School of Nurse Training was created. It was supported by the Women's Division of the Methodist Board of Missions. The hospital first opened in the West Monroe building. Later, it grew and opened other locations in East Jacksonville and Springfield.

Famous Nurse from Brewster Hospital

A military nurse named Abbie Sweetwine got her first nurse training at Brewster Hospital. She became famous as "The Angel of Platform 6" for her brave work during a big train crash in Britain.

How Brewster Hospital Changed

Brewster Hospital closed in 1966. This happened because of new laws, like the Civil Rights Act of 1964. These laws meant that hospitals could no longer be separate for different races. White hospitals had to start treating all patients. Because of this, hospitals like Brewster, which served only Black patients, lost their special funding.

The Springfield building that was part of Brewster Hospital was later rebuilt. It became Methodist Hospital in 1967. This hospital then changed names a few times. It eventually merged with another center to become Shands Jacksonville Medical Center. This center is connected to the University of Florida.

The Original Building Today

The very first Brewster Hospital building was built in 1885 as a home. It was bought in 1901 to be the hospital. It stayed in use until the hospital closed in 1966.

Around the mid-2000s, the city of Jacksonville moved the old building to a new spot nearby. They spent a lot of money to fix it up. As of 2020, a group called North Florida Land Trust uses the building.
